Handover — Velstrom Gateway hot-reload

Tomas, before I go on leave: the hot-reload watcher on Velstrom Gateway now picks up config changes within five seconds, no restart needed. Please verify the checksum log after each reload, since a malformed file silently falls back to the previous snapshot. Priya has reviewed the reload path and signed off for the 4.2 release. For reference during the cutover, the current live configuration values are as follows.

deployment values, yadug-bawif:
[framir]
team = pelox
access_code = ac_a38ab2
owner = tamion.julael
host = framir.tolvaqlabs.test
port = 11211
peer = tammir.zemvargrid.local
salt = 2215ef03
pin = 1541

## Further Reading

Fabrikit's trait-resolution order is subtle, and most maintainer confusion stems from how nested factories inherit sequence counters. Before modifying the resolver, read the design notes from the Quillmere rewrite, which explain why lazy attributes are evaluated per-build rather than per-class. The full rationale, including rejected alternatives, lives on our internal wiki page.

runbook for badug-kadup: https://confluence.zemvarlabs.internal/projects/browse/display/projects/bd1b

### Runbook: BounceBroom — Account Recovery

If the BounceBroom email bounce processor loses access to its service account, do not create a new one. First, pause the intake queue so bounces buffer safely. Then open the recovery console and select the BounceBroom principal. Verification requires approval from the on-call lead. Once approved, the console prompts for the stored recovery credentials; enter the passphrase that appears directly below this paragraph.

recovery phrase for fahof-kahap: holion-gormir-jorix-istix-briwyn-sorael